Motorola Droid – How to install custom rom’s – The EASY way!

March 13th, 2010 jedwan 25 comments


PLEASE READ – PLEASE READ – PLEASE READ – PLEASE READ ****YOU MUST BE ROOTED**** *** New update at the bottom of the description 2-10-10*** Step 1 DOWNLOAD THIS FILE download510.mediafire.com Save to desktop Step 2 Take the smoked glass zip file and extract it to the desktop, you may rename the folder to what you want, but DO NOT tamper with the files inside! Step 3 Drag the folder that you just extracted (smoked glass v4) to your sdcard- YOU MUST PLACE IT IN THE “nandroid” folder, no other location, no other subfolders. Step 4 Reeboot in recovery mode – Power on by pushing power button and holding X at the same time. Step 5 Go to advanced nandroid restore, click on choose backup, find the ROM you want, in this case, smoked glass v4, then hit the enter button, then leave the default options checked, hit perform restore, then back out by pushing the power button, then hit reboot, and your done!
